Output deaab76cf76275ea28bae4194013f57794f6e46cbe91ab478640aecb7917b032:1

value
15704567
script pubkey
OP_0 OP_PUSHBYTES_20 18cd9d9c0365eedad8960fa25d97f15958ed2f61
address
bc1qrrxem8qrvhhd4kykp739m9l3t9vw6tmp48xhps
transaction
deaab76cf76275ea28bae4194013f57794f6e46cbe91ab478640aecb7917b032
confirmations
171891
spent
true